Panthers Head to the Semifinals
- Updated: October 16, 2015

The Panthers offensive line (left) averaged 7 yards per play against the Chiefs
MERIDEN, CT- The Panthers jumped out to a 22-0 lead to defeat the Chiefs in the Colonial Conference Divisional Round. The win sends the Panthers to their fourth straight Semifinal Round game.
The Panthers dominated play early with quarterback Rich Snowden hitting Ziggy Bailey for an 11 yard score. Later in the half Jamie Bryant was inserted and found an open Akwon Shabazz in the end zone. With time expiring in the half Bryant took the snap, changed directions three times before finding Kyle Watkins for a 23 yard touchdown catch to deflate the upstart Chiefs. “After two tight regular season games against each other few people thought this would be how the Chiefs would start the game” said a fellow conference coach, “the Panthers come to play in the playoffs”.
The second half saw the Champions defense take over the game. David Reese, Dustin Lindon, and Moose Welch all found their way to quarterback Dino Mancinelli for drive stopping sacks. The final nail in the coffin came when Shante Wynn picked off a pass and returned it 50 yards for the final Panther score of the night. “Our defense closes out the game” said Lindon, “if our offense gets a lead it’s our job to secure it”.
The panthers will travel to Danbury Saturday night to take on the Western Connecticut Militia who defeated the Pioneer Valley Knights in their playoff match up.
